Citrus Shrimp Ceviche Burst

Experience the zesty explosion of fresh shrimp marinated in tangy citrus juices, combined with the crunch of colorful vegetables and the kick of jalapenos. This vibrant ceviche recipe is a true flavor burst that will transport your taste buds to culinary bliss.
ingredients
- 1 lb fresh shrimp, deveined and peeled
- 4 limes, juiced
- 2 lemons, juiced
- 1 orange, juiced
- 1 red bell pepper, diced
- 1 small red onion, finely chopped
- 1 jalapeno, seeds removed and finely chopped
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 avocado, diced
- 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- Tortilla chips, for serving
steps
- 1.
In a medium bowl, combine the shrimp, lime juice, lemon juice, and orange juice. Let it marinate for 15 minutes in the refrigerator.
- 2.
Meanwhile, in a separate bowl, mix together the red bell pepper, red onion, jalapeno, cherry tomatoes, avocado, and cilantro.
- 3.
After the shrimp has marinated, remove it from the citrus juice and chop it into small pieces. Add the chopped shrimp to the vegetable mixture.
- 4.
Season with salt and pepper to taste and gently toss everything together to ensure the flavors are well combined.
- 5.
Allow the ceviche to ch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to let the flavors meld together.
- 6.
Serve chilled with tortilla chips for dipping and enjoy this refreshing, citrusy, and zesty shrimp ceviche.
